F3 carbs/jet kit
 
first off, are all F3 carbs interchangeable? i just picked up a set of carbs off ebay, the guy wasnt sure what year they were off of, but that they were off of a F3, second, it is suppossed to have a jet kit, I was wondering what i should look for to identify the jet kit and how extreme it is (stage 1, 2, etc), the only thing i've seen so far is that the Main jets say FACTORY on them, but i didnt see any modifications, but then again im not really sure hwat im looking for

All I can say is that the jets should have a number on the side of them and if that number matches the size called out in the repair manual...then it's got stock jets. I had to do that with a set of R6 carbs that I had. Not sure if this helps or not.

Factory is a brand of jet kits. It does have a jet kit in it. If it is really a stage 2, you'll have to go to the Factory web site and see what a stage 2 includes. I've looked over the site once and it explains what each kit does in performance enhancements. There is some cool stuff on the site too, I don't know if any of it is still available though.
